We were founded by Axel Springer in 2018 as a 100 percent owned company and combine the digital activities and participations in real estate, car and generalist classifieds in Germany 🇩🇪 (Immowelt), France 🇫🇷 (Meilleurs Agents, Groupe SeLoger, Logic-Immo, Car & Boat Media), Belgium 🇧🇪 (Immoweb), Spain 🇪🇸 (Housell) and Israel 🇮🇱 (Yad2), making us one of the world’s biggest digital classified players. 

We also hold Axel Springer’s minority participation in companies such as Purplebricks, Homeday and Zumper. Our vision is to serve consumers in their important decisions in life and to simplify not only the search for a new property or car but to also provide additional services in adjacent markets.
